Here you go, I finally managed to encode it:



As you can see, it is still very sloppy and there is plenty to improve. Also I had no buying strategy for this run so I was just messing around on the buy screens to figure out what I could do, this is what I use now:

Level 4: Lock picking + armor 1
Level 6: Slide
Level 8: Bugs + armor 2

I also bought the quiet running because I have that in NG+ and I didn't know if the run would be messed up without it, but I think you can safely ignore it. Armor 2 may be removable, but I don't think armor 1 can be due to places you are likely to get shot in the fastest routes. That may need testing.

Also for fun, the weird bug I had with the smoke bomb happens at ~14:00 when I try to smoke the lasers:


I throw the smoke bomb in the air (you can see the animation change from an air roll to just falling), but it doesn't come out. So I sit there confused for a second and throw a second one, spawning the first one I threw in the air. Also, I found a trick in level 7 (catacombs) that saves roughly 10 seconds.  If you hold left immediately after you reach the end of the roflwalk above the stage while you're falling, you can grab the wall as it drops down above the area where the level ends.  This will immediately end the level, instead of waiting for you to hit the ground and walk left a bit.  I'll see if I can get a video of this effect later on this evening...

I gave a try at the method Austin was describing for vents, and he is right, it is 100% consistent, I will get a video and explain the inputs. So you can ignore those videos above, the vent is definitely faster now. =) It won't work on all vents as Austin said, only those that you can't run up the walls, since you abuse this to use sprint correctly.

EDIT

Here it is:


Inputs are:
- Enter the vent (This is actually a requirement, you need to be stood exactly where you are after entering the vent)
- Sprint right until pressed against wall.
- Sprint left until pressed against wall.
- Wallkick.

You can hold sprint the entire time.

Quote from KingdomNerdia:
I assume the Far Sight is so that you don't grab the wall?

It's two-fold. It's so you can't grab the wall, but also so that you can't press your face against the wall once you hit the ground. Pressing your face against the wall pushes you back, which messes up the spacing. You can use a cardboard box as well, but since farsight is always selected for you, it is faster. The idea came to me when I did the spike mine trick on the left wall. The punch strategy will work if you can get yourself maximum distance into the wall, so if you can find a way to do it on levels 1 through 4 on NG Any%, that would improve the experience of that run a lot.

Quote from KingdomNerdia:
This could actually drop the NG+ any% time by at least a minute.

In theory, yes. There is a problem with it in that it only travels for ~3 seconds before stopping and the setup takes about 1 second if done quickly, so you only net yourself about 1-2 seconds of super-speed. If you can fly off a building, you get yourself some more time too. To gain 1 minute you need to get ~30 of them in total, which is quite a hard task to achieve. However, it is a time saver and in a run like NG+ Any% any time saved is nice to push that 18:xx.

So I was sat in Mark of the Ninja, minding my own business, when I casually discovered something quite interesting:
I FOUND A 100% CONSISTENT WALLKICK METHOD REQUIRING NO ITEMS WHATSOEVER

I'll let that sink in for a moment for you NG Any% fanatics, then you can read the next big text:
IT IS FASTER THAN THE FARSIGHT METHOD (!)

Here it is:


Inputs are:
- Face away from the wall
- Jump straight up
- Air attack
- Hold towards wall (and don't let go)
- Wallkick

There is actually a way to do the backwards air kick while sprinting, but it can take a while to get used to. This has some pretty serious implications:
IT ALLOWS YOU TO DO A CONSISTENT FIRST TIME WALLKICK (!!!)

Albeit, it's slightly slower because you very briefly move backwards, but it's close enough and above all it is consistent. Not only this, it is very easy to set up the second wallkick if you mess up the backwards air kick while sprinting.

Here is sprinting backwards air kick method:


Inputs are:
- Sprint towards wall
- Jump
- Tap away from the wall
- Air kick
- Hold towards the wall
- Wallkick

The inputs need to be quite fast and you need to do it quite close to the wall, but if you can get good at it, the actual wallkick itself is consistent. There may be a better way to do it, but this is what I found while messing around for a few minutes. Again, if you screw this up, you can just walk away from the wall and do the regular backwards kick method, which is much much easier.

This also has some implications on routing. We can start adding wallkicks to save small amounts of time in any level, since it is fast and isn't dependent on any items. I'm sure there are plenty of these. One that comes to mind is skipping the push box in level 7. By running past it to the right hand wall and kicking through there, time can be saved by avoiding the box push.
